Bellevue West hasn't had much luck against Millard South recently, but that could start to change on Saturday. The Thunderbirds will take on the Patriots at 9:00 a.m. Bellevue West has given up an average of 9.3 runs per game this season, but Saturday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
Bellevue West's tournament run continued when they took on Skutt Catholic on Friday. The Thunderbirds lost 17-4 to the SkyHawks.
Bellevue West saw four different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Jaycee Woodard, who went 1-for-2 with two RBI and one run. Leah Hanson was another, going a perfect 2-for-2 with one run and one RBI.
Meanwhile, Millard South came up short against Omaha Westside on Friday and fell 7-4.
Bellevue West's loss dropped their record down to 1-8. As for Millard South, their defeat dropped their record down to 3-6.
Bellevue West might still be hurting after the 14-2 loss they got from Millard South when the teams last played on Tuesday. Can the Thunderbirds av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
